Responsibilities
As a Systems Safety Engineer here at Honeywell, you will have the opportunity to impact the development of safety-critical systems and cutting-edge Avionics solutions for the Honeywell Anthem Flight Deck System. As a flagship product, the Honeywell Anthem Flight Deck System is not just another avionics product; it is a visionary endeavor that employs cutting-edge technologies to redefine how pilots interact with flight information and aircraft systems.

Responsibilities
  • Support the development and management of system safety requirements , ensuring proper allocation, traceability, validation, and verification
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ams including systems, software, hardware, safety, and certification engineering
  • Support system design and architecture activities to ensure safety considerations are incorporated early and throughout development
  • Contribute to systems integration efforts , identifying and addressing safety impacts across interfaces and subsystems
  • Perform or support system safety analyses , including:
    • Functional Hazard Analysis (FHA)
    • Fault Tree Analysis (FTA)
    • Failure Modes and Effects Analysis (FMEA)
    • Common Mode Analysis (CMA)
  • Support compliance with applicable aerospace safety standards and regulatory guidance
  • Assist with technical documentation, reviews, and certification artifacts in accordance with Honeywell processes

Qualifications
YOU MUST HAVE
  • Bachelor's degree from an accredited institution in a technical discipline such as the sciences, technology, engineering or mathematics
  • Systems Engineering / Safety Engineering experience (open to varying experience levels from Engr II through Senior levels)
WE VALUE
  • Knowledge of systems development lifecycle
  • Knowledge in any of the following is of value:
    • CAFTA experience
    • Part 25 aircraft exposure
    • Flight control safety experience
    • System safety analyses (e.g. FHA, FTA, FMEA, CMA, etc)
